Structural Design of UAV Thin Composite Wing with High Aspect Ratio
ZHANG Xueming,CAO Weijun,ZHANG Xiaomu,XIA Yang (The6oth Research Institute of CRTC,Nanjing 21oo16,China)
Abstract:A composite wing with smallthicknessand high-bearing beam is designed to meet the requirements of the highaspect ratio thincomposite wingofa high speed UAV.Its strength was checkedand ballst was tested,and the rigid strength provedtobe satisfied,butthe weight failed.To met the weight index asrequired,thetopology optimization design of the wing was made.By variable density method,topological structure was obtained and redesigned,and its strengthcheck andballast test werecarriedout.Compared withtheoriginal structure,the weightof the topological structure was reduced by 29% ,with great improvement in stiffness. The optimized structure meets the requirements as designed.
